编程启蒙之旅:从Scratch到Python
1. 编程是什么?
编程,简单来说,就是编写一组指令告诉计算机该做什么。计算机有自己的语言,称为机器码,但这种语言对我们来说过于复杂和低效。因此,我们使用更接近自然语言的编程语言,如Python和C++,来编写代码。这些编程语言需要被翻译成机器码,解释器、编译器和汇编器就是用来完成这个任务的工具。
编程不仅仅是编写代码,它还涉及创造力和解决问题的能力。编程可以用来创建艺术作品、设计网站、开发游戏、构建图形模拟、讲述故事,甚至把飞船送入太空。它为每个人打开了无限的可能性。编程是一项充满乐趣和挑战的技能,它不仅能够帮助你实现自己的想法,还能让你在解决问题的过程中获得极大的满足感。
2. 编程的重要性
环顾四周,你会发现我们生活中充满了电子设备和技术产品。从智能手机到智能家居,从洗衣机到恒温器,几乎所有现代设备都依赖于编程来实现其功能。编程已经成为一项基本技能,如同几百年前的阅读和写作一样重要。它不仅能帮你找到一份好工作,还能训练你的思维,提高解决问题的能力。
编程的重要性不仅体现在职业发展上,还体现在日常生活中。编程可以帮助你更好地理解和使用现代科技,从而提高生活质量。例如,你可以通过编程来创建个性化的天气传感器、健康监测器,甚至是带有LED灯的万圣节服装。编程还可以让你参与到网络安全领域,保障他人计算机和系统的安全。
3. 编程语言的选择
3.1 Scratch
Scratch是一种可视化的编程语言,非常适合初学者和孩子们。它通过拖拽积木块的方式简化了编程过程,使编程变得更加直观和有趣。Scratch附带了大量的图形和声音库,